齿轮箱箱体结构对其振动模态的影响研究

摘    要:借助I-DEAS和NASTRAN软件平台对某齿轮箱进行了振动模态分析,研究并讨论了齿轮箱箱体结构型式对振动模态的影响,分析并验证了结构布局、大弧面和加强筋是提高齿轮箱箱体的抗振能力的重要途径,其结论可以为齿轮箱的动态设计提供参考。

Study on Vibration Modal of the Different Gearbox-box Structure

Abstract:The vibration modal of a gearbox is analyzed in detail based on I-DEAS and NASTRAN software. The effect caused by different structure of the gearbox box on vibration modal are studied and discussed. Construction arrangement,lager camber and stiffener that can improve the auti-vibration design of gearbox are analyzed and confirmed. The conclusions can be used as a reference of the dynamic design of gearbox.
